RAID 6,raid6需要几块硬盘
2026-04-01 07:42:02 来源:技王数据恢复

黎明前的至暗时刻:为什么RAID5不再让你安稳入睡?
在数据存储的江湖里,RAID5曾经是那个平衡性能、空间利用率与安全性的“完美侠客”。它通过奇偶校验位(Parity)提供了一份冗余,允许在一块硬盘损坏的情况下,依然能保持系统运行并重建数据。随着单块硬盘容量从TB级向PB级狂飙,这个原本稳固的平衡正在被打破。
想象一下这个场景:你的一台核心存储服务器中,某块16TB的硬盘突然亮起了红灯。你长舒一口气,心想:“还好我有RAID5,换块新的就行。”但当你插入新盘,系统开始漫长的重建(Rebuild)过程时,真正的危机才刚刚开始。在这个过程中,剩余的所有硬盘都必须高负荷运转,去填补那个丢失的空洞。
此时,如果由于长时间的高负载读写,另一块硬盘不幸出现了坏道(URE,不可恢复的读取错误),或者直接“罢工”,那么RAID5的逻辑链条就会彻底断裂,你的所有数据——无论是珍贵的商业机密还是核心交易记录——都将化为乌有。
这就是所谓的“重建风险”。在超大容量硬盘普及的今天,RAID5的单盘容错能力在概率论面前显得捉襟见肘。正是在这种背景下,RAID6以一种近乎“偏执”的防御姿态,走进了架构师的视野。
RAID6:数据堡垒的双重锁扣
RAID6,通常被称为“独立磁盘双冗余校验阵列”。如果说RAID5是为硬盘加了一份意外险,那么RAID6就是双重保险。它在RAID5的基础上,引入了第二套独立的奇偶校验信息(通常称为P+Q校验)。这意味着,即便在同一个磁盘阵列中,有两块硬盘同时罢工,你的数据依然稳如泰山。
这种设计并非简单的堆砌。在技术底层,RAID6采用了更加复杂的数学逻辑。除了RAID5常用的异或(XOR)运算生成的第一层校验(P)外,它还通过里德-所罗门编码(Reed-Solomoncodes)或者更复杂的伽罗华域(GaloisField)运算,计算出第二层校验(Q)。
这两套校验信息被交错分布在阵列中的每一块硬盘上。
这种“P+Q”的架构,赋予了RAID6极高的容错弹性。在最极端的情况下,如果你在进行硬盘重建时,发现另一块盘也出现了故障,RAID6依然能通过剩余的盘符和两套校验值,精准地反推并重构出原始数据。对于那些视数据如生命的企业来说,这不仅仅是多了一块盘的容错,而是将系统遭遇毁灭性故障的概率,从百分比直接降到了天文数字般的低位。
空间与安全的博弈:一种明智的投资
很多人诟病RAID6“浪费”了两个磁盘的空间。比如在一个8盘位的系统中,你只能享受到6块盘的容量。如果我们换个视角看,这种“浪费”实际上是极其高效的风险投资。
在过去,IT管理者往往追求极致的性价比,但在数字化转型深入的今天,宕机一小时带来的损失,往往足以购买几打最高规格的硬盘。RAID6所占用的那部分空间,换取的是在系统最脆弱时刻的从容。它让运维人员不必在半夜接到报修电话时冷汗直流,也让企业在面对大规模硬件损耗时,拥有了战略级的缓冲空间。
性能、算法与权衡:RAID6背后的硬核艺术
当我们谈论RAID6时,不可避免地会触及它的一个潜在标签:写入惩罚(WritePenalty)。由于每次写入数据都需要同时计算并更新两个校验位,RAID6在写入性能上的开销确实高于RAID5。对于早期的存储控制器来说,这确实是一个沉重的负担。
但硬件进化的速度远超想象。现代的企业级RAID控制器,内置了专门的硬件加速引擎(ASIC),专门负责处理复杂的P+Q代数运算。这意味着,在大多数实际应用场景中,用户几乎感受不到那种理论上的延迟。更重要的是,在读取操作方面,RAID6由于数据分布在更多的物理磁盘上,其并发读取性能往往非常出色,甚至能与RAID0相媲美。
对于需要高可靠性、高读取吞吐量,但对写入瞬时波动有一定包容度的场景,RAID6几乎是不二之选。比如,超大规模的视频监控系统、医疗影像数据库,或者是企业的二级备份存储池。在这些场景中,数据一旦存入,最重要的就是“别丢”,而RAID6正是那个最忠诚的守门人。
实战场景:RAID6的最佳栖息地
究竟哪些业务应该毫不犹豫地选择RAID6?首先是大数据分析平台。在处理数PB级别的海量信息时,单节点故障是常态。RAID6能确保在多点故障并发时,计算集群不至于因为某个阵列的崩溃而停摆。
其次是对于数据完整性要求极高的科研与金融领域。在这些领域,任何比特位的丢失都可能导致研究结论的偏差或金融账目的混乱。RAID6的双校验机制提供了一种数学上的确定性,它比RAID5更能抵抗“静默数据损坏”(SilentDataCorruption)的侵蚀。
在NAS(网络附属存储)领域,RAID6正逐渐成为中高端型号的默认推荐设置。随着18TB、22TB甚至更大容量硬盘的普及,RAID5的重建周期可能长达数天甚至一周。在这漫长的周期内,系统处于一种裸奔状态,任何微小的波动都是致命的。而RAID6则为你买了一张“安心票”,让你在重建期间依然拥有冗余保护,这种心理上的安全感和实际上的数据抗风险能力,是任何软件层面优化都无法完全替代的。
RAID6的未来:在多云与混合存储时代的定位
随着云存储和分布式文件系统的兴起,有人预言传统的物理RAID将会消失。但现实是,无论云端多么虚幻,底层依然是由一块块物理硬盘组成的阵列。在分布式架构中,RAID6常被用作单节点内部的数据保护层,与跨节点的副本机制(ErasureCoding)共同构成多级防御体系。
这正体现了RAID6的设计哲学:不把鸡蛋放在一个篮子里,甚至不把篮子放在一根绳子上。它代表了一种对概率的敬畏,一种对“墨菲定律”的主动出击。
结语:为你的数据穿上“黄金铠甲”
选择RAID6,本质上是在选择一种生存策略。在追求效率的今天,我们往往容易忽视那些藏在冰山下的风险。RAID6就像是潜水员背后的备用氧气瓶,或者是飞机上的双引擎冗余,在99%的时间里,它默默无闻,甚至让你觉得有些冗余;但在那关键的1%故障时刻,它就是划分生存与毁灭的边界线。
如果你的数据资产价值连城,如果你无法承受连续丢失两块盘后的万丈深渊,那么RAID6就是你存储架构中不可或缺的压舱石。它不仅仅是一种技术规范,更是一种关于数据尊严的承诺:无论世界如何动荡,你的数字遗产,始终在此,分毫不差。